Frequently Asked Questions About Affiliate Marketing Firms
What services do affiliate marketing companies provide?
Affiliate marketing agencies provide a broad spectrum of services aimed at elevating businesses’ commissions and revenue through a network of partners or affiliates.
While many people associate affiliates strictly with social media influencers and public figures, professional affiliate marketing agencies manage a much broader ecosystem of niche content creators, review sites, coupon and loyalty portals, and larger media publishers.
These partners promote a product or service to their established audiences, earning a commission only when a verified sale or lead is generated through their unique tracking affiliate link. An affiliate program generally follows a B2C (business-to-consumer) model, but B2B arrangements also exist.
Key services of affiliate marketing companies encompass:
Program setup
Affiliate marketing strategy
Partners recruitment
Commission management
Affiliate vetting
Performance reporting
What types of affiliate marketing are there?
Affiliate marketing is traditionally categorized by the relationship between the marketer and the product, as well as the promotional medium used. Professional affiliate engagement typically falls into three distinct categories:
Involved affiliate marketing: This model relies on firsthand experience. The affiliate uses and endorses the product through reviews and tutorials. This type has shown to deliver a better conversion rate and make the business a trusted brand.
Related affiliate marketing: The marketer operates within the same industry or niche as the product but does not necessarily use it personally. For example, a financial blog may promote a specific credit card to its established audience.
Unattached affiliate marketing: A purely performance-based model where the affiliate has no direct connection to the product or its niche. The affiliate runs pay-per-click (PPC) campaigns and places the affiliate link in ads, hoping consumers click and purchase.
How much do these services cost?
Across industries, the median affiliate commission rates stand at 5% to 30% of the sale amount. This percentage tends to be higher when collaborating with retail, beauty, and fashion brands, while B2B, electronics and other high-end products pay on the lower end. And that's only for the commissions payout.
To this sum, businesses need to factor in an additional $2,000 to $10,000 per month for the affiliate marketing company. The scope usually dictates the service fee, finalized based on the number of affiliates, campaign setup, creative production, reporting, and optimization.
In terms of the payment method, there are a few main models to choose from:
Pay-per-sale: Pays a percentage of earn commissions
Pay-per-lead: Pays for qualified referrals
Pay-per-click: Offers small payments per each visitor
Pay-per-install: Pays for each app/software download and install
How are commissions usually tiered?
Affiliate marketing companies usually structure the commission based on the complexity of the conversion and the level of creator influence. Here are the average commissions and payouts businesses can expect:
Reach and engagement: 5% to 20%
Revenue-share tiers: 15% to 30%
Flat fee or revenue-share agreements: Around 15%
Referred sale commission: 5% to 25%
Performance-based influencer compensation: 5% to 20%
What is the difference between affiliate marketing and influencer marketing?
The main distinction between affiliate marketing and influencer marketing lies in the primary objective and the corresponding compensation structure.
Affiliate marketing is primarily a performance-oriented model whereaffiliates earn commissions exclusively for prompting specific actions. The engagement delivers immediate return on investment (ROI) and functions as a direct sales channel. Consequently, the relationship between the brand and the affiliate is purely transactional.
By contrast, influencer marketing uses a creator's social influence and audience to cultivate brand awareness and brand trust. Compensation in this model typically involves an upfront flat fee or product gifting in exchange for creative content and visibility.
In essence, affiliate marketing agencies focus on the bottom of the sales funnel, while influencer agencies target the top by putting more emphasis on the narrative and brand resonance.
